Transaction 39bed71c8512707ce26c0e3f63f7039ada09da53c2cd8a958b1886e5d2da9047

3 Input
2 Outputs
  • 39bed71c8512707ce26c0e3f63f7039ada09da53c2cd8a958b1886e5d2da9047:0
  • value  403816065
    address  1AkWydJHS8m4zu9PYCiTxEtAEmiqgPN4bg
  • 39bed71c8512707ce26c0e3f63f7039ada09da53c2cd8a958b1886e5d2da9047:1
  • value  80276036
    address  125DPQJ87qideZwKuRxdbjCUJ8J9EGLWa3